Motorcycle Santa - Special Times

The children in Johnny Cellphone's house had just got up out of bed and were still dressed in their pajamas.

Six-year-old Caroline, with her long golden curly hair, had on her favorite pink nightgown. She ran up to Motorcycle Santa and yelled up at him, "My Daddy painted my room pink just for me. I have a pink dresser, a pink bed, a pink bedspread, a pink pig, a pink pillow, a pink phone, a pink ..."

"Wait a minute there Caroline," Motorcycle Santa spoke in a soft voice to his pink friend. "Do you want a world all filled with pink? We need more colors than pink. And please don't yell, sweetie. You'll wake up your Mommy. You need to be quiet. Shh."

"I know, but I like pink. Pink, pink, pink. Did you bring me anything pink?" she asked.

"Sorry, Caroline, but I'm low on pink this year," he said. "So I guess you want me to make more pink toys for next year. Is that right?"

"Pink is for little girls," Caroline said.

Her brother, Connor, interrupted with, "Girls are stupid." Connor is eight.

"I am not stupid! You're stupid," returned Caroline.

"Please kids, I'm here to get your help about what you think I should make for new toys next year," said Motorcycle Santa. "We can't do that if you're going to fight with each other."

"Well, I'd like to see a pink motorcycle," said Caroline. "My Daddy's motorcycle is all green and chrome looking. I never see pink motorcycles. When I get old enough to ride, I'm going to paint my bike pink. I think that we need to have pink motorcycle toys now to get people thinking about big pink motorcycles when they learn to ride. What do you say? What do you say? Please. Can you make some pink toy motorcycles? And, and, please leave me one next year for Christmas."

Hard to argue with a six-year-old curly headed girl with her mind made up, thought Motorcycle Santa.

"I'll see what I can do," said Motorcycle Santa.
